The NVMT 2x24 Gen 2+ may look like the NVMT 2x24 Gen 1, but that is where the similarities end. The NVMT 2x24’s premium Gen 2+ image intensifier tube makes all the difference, resulting in a higher performance.
All image intensifier tubes work by using a photocathode to transform the gathered light into electrons, which then pass through the tube and bombard a Phosphor screen to produce the green illumination of an image.
The difference between Gen 1 and Gen 2+ is that the Gen 2+ uses a tiny glass disc that has millions of microscopic holes in it with metal electrodes, known as a Microchannel Plate (MCP). This MCP is placed before the Phosphor screen and acts as an electron multiplier, which increases light sensitivity. Since the MCP actually increases the number of electrons instead of just accelerating the original ones, the images are significantly less distorted and brighter than Gen 1 night vision devices.
Generation 2+ night vision units have shown major improvements in image resolution and general performance and are considerably more reliable. The biggest gain in Generation 2 is the ability to see in extremely low light conditions, such as a moonless night, without the use of an infrared (IR) illuminator.
Though the use of an infrared illuminator isn’t necessary with Gen 2+ night vision units, the NVMT 2x24 Gen 2+ comes with the exclusive built-in PULSE** IR Illuminator for use in total darkness. The IR Illuminator expands the unit’s viewing range and minimizes battery drainage, in addition to staying invisible to the human eye.
The unit is powered by a 3V Lithium CR123A battery. A green LED indicates the power status of the unit and a red LED indicates the IR Illuminator’s power. Newly developed, fully multicoated optics that decrease glare and improve light transmission, provide excellent viewing through improved wavelength/contrast characteristics. The NVMT embraces modern, cutting-edge technology, without forgetting practicality. The 13 oz., ergonomically-designed NVMT is small enough to fit in the palm of your hand, pocket or backpack.
The NVMT consists of the normal night vision ingredients: optics (glass),
a system of electronics (batteries, wire, transformer, regulators and capacitors) and an image intensifier tube, which creates the viewed image. When viewing through the NVMT you will see a greenish image due to the nature of night vision. The unit’s lens cap is equipped with a small pin hole to allow daytime viewing without destroying the image intensifier tube.
